At my library we recently switched from the older EDS interface to their new interface, and since then the Zotero Connector is not behaving as one should expect. I have read other posts here about similar issues, but I don't really understand if the problem is related to Zotero or EBSCO.

When in the result list, the Zotero Connector does not show as the yellow folder, but as "Web Page with Snap Shot". Thus, it's not possible so save multiple references from the result list using Zotero Connector.

Another issue is that, when going to a specific article post in EDS, the Zotero Connector icon shows as a book, even though it's an article I'm looking at. Everything works fine when importing the article, but it's confusing that it's the book icon that is being shown as the Zotero Connector icon, even though it's an article.

So, is this something that can be fixed by the Zotero Community, or do we need to contact EBSCO about this?

  • When you hover over the Save to Zotero icon, does it list "EBSCO Discovery Layer"? It looks like it might be using the generic EBSCOHost translator.

    Either way, though, you should be able to somehow get to RIS data (I forgot where exactly the button is -- something like Cite or Export). Can you download that, open it in a text editor and paste it here?
    Zotero takes pretty much exactly what it gets from the discovery layer, so as long as it's working at all, this is likely a metadata problem

  • So the "TY GEN" is what is causing the classification of these books as articles?
  • edited 29 days ago
    Yeah, the data are bad -- TY - GEN should be TY - BOOK, there's also stry information in the title (TI) field, there's stuff in the author (AU) field that shouldn't be there (e.g. the affiliation and in some cases the publisher listed as an author), the is no place of publication, the date field contains (almost certainly incorrect) information about the _day_ of publication -- there's likely more. I don't know how EDS works exactly, but typically, discovery layers map information from your library catalog (typicallly in MARC) to their internal data format. Clearly, something is going wrong in that process here -- I don't think that's generally the case for EDS; the other instances I worked with seemed pretty decent. You should talk to the vendor about this.
    Once that's fixed, Zotero's import, via the browser icon, will work as expected (though as I note above, the icon displayed will not always be a reliable indicator of what is actually imported).
